Definition and Functionality of Endoscopic Needles in Medicine

Endoscopic needles play a vital role in modern medical procedures, especially for minimally invasive surgeries. These specialized tools allow for precise tissue sampling and fluid aspiration. Their design facilitates access to hard-to-reach areas within the body, enhancing diagnostic capabilities. The needles can be used in various procedures, such as biopsies and fluid drainage.

The functionality of endoscopic needles is remarkable. They can easily penetrate tissues while minimizing damage to surrounding structures. This feature reduces recovery time for patients. Endoscopic needles are often employed during endoscopic procedures, where visualization is critical. These needles can also be adapted for different tasks, highlighting their versatility.

Despite their significance, there are areas that require careful consideration. Not all procedures may benefit equally from their use. Complications can arise, and a thorough understanding of the anatomy is essential. Training and experience are crucial for healthcare providers. Each procedure should be approached with caution, balancing risks and benefits. Continuous feedback and improvement are key to enhancing effectiveness.

Various Types of Endoscopic Needles and Their Specific Uses

Endoscopic needles play a crucial role in modern medical procedures. They allow for targeted interventions in various organs. Different types of endoscopic needles are designed for specific uses. For instance, there are fine-needle aspirators. These needles collect samples from tissues with minimal invasiveness. The samples are vital for diagnostics and treatment planning.

Another type is the coaxial needle. It is essential for complex procedures, providing stability during access. This improves accuracy, especially in delicate areas. However, the use of these needles is not without challenges. Misplacement can lead to complications. Clinicians must be skilled and careful. The learning curve can be steep, and sometimes mistakes occur.

Ultrasound-guided needles enhance visual clarity. They help physicians navigate through tissues more effectively. Despite advancements, complications still happen. Not all procedures yield perfect results. Reflection on these outcomes is crucial for improvement. Each type of endoscopic needle has advantages and drawbacks. Understanding their specific uses is key for successful medical interventions.

Challenges and Limitations of Endoscopic Needle Use in Healthcare

Why is Endoscopic Needle Essential for Modern Medical Procedures?

The use of endoscopic needles in medical procedures brings many advancements. However, challenges surround their application in healthcare. For instance, the complexity of the procedure can deter some practitioners. Training is essential, yet many healthcare professionals may not receive adequate instruction. This gap can lead to complications or ineffective treatments.

Patient safety is also a significant concern. Endoscopic procedures carry risks of infection and perforation. Even with skilled hands, things can go wrong. Proper sterilization of equipment is crucial but sometimes overlooked in high-pressure environments. Additionally, the anatomical variations in patients can complicate the procedure, presenting further challenges for the physician.

Cost can be another barrier. While the technology advances, so do the expenses associated with endoscopic needles. Hospitals may struggle with investment in sufficient tools or training resources. This affects the accessibility of these procedures to diverse patient populations. As a result, there is a pressing need for reflection and improvement in the way endoscopic needles are utilized in modern healthcare settings.

Enhancing Diagnostic Accuracy: A Comprehensive Review of EMR Instruments Endoscopic Needles' Impact on Bronchoscope, Gastroscope, and Enteroscope Procedures

In recent years, the integration of advanced endoscopic instruments has significantly improved the precision and efficacy of diagnostic procedures involving bronchoscopy, gastroscopy, and enteroscopy. Particularly, emerging research highlights the crucial role of specific EMR (endoscopic mucosal resection) instruments, such as specialized endoscopic needles, in enhancing diagnostic accuracy. These instruments, characterized by their individualized design, facilitate better tissue sampling, which is vital for accurate pathological assessment and diagnosis.

The latest industry reports indicate that proper instrument channel sizing is essential for successful procedures, with many advanced endoscopic techniques requiring tools that fit seamlessly within 2.0 mm and 2.8 mm instrument channels. For instance, needles with working lengths of 4 mm, 5 mm, and 6 mm allow for greater versatility in different anatomical regions. The ergonomic, easy-grip handle design fosters improved control during delicate procedures, which can minimize complications and enhance overall patient safety. Additionally, the use of sterilized 304 stainless steel needles presents an opportunity to reduce infection risk in single-use applications.

Recent studies emphasize the growing trend towards the adoption of customized working lengths in endoscopic procedures. This flexibility is particularly advantageous in tailored medical approaches, where variables like patient anatomy and specific clinical scenarios dictate the need for bespoke solutions. As the healthcare industry increasingly turns to evidence-based innovations, the benefits of utilizing high-quality, single-use endoscopic needles could lead to improved patient outcomes and a significant boost in procedural efficacy across various diagnostic platforms.
